Oven-baked Red Mullet with rice

Fresh, whole red mullet baked with a thyme fragranced rice

  1. Firstly, fry off the onion and garlic in a saucepan.
  2. Preheat oven to 250C. In a deep baking dish, combine the uncooked rice with the onion & garlic mixture, fish stock, thyme, mixed herbs and parmesan cheese. Cover, place in the oven and bake for 15 minutes.
  3. Next, remove the rice from the oven and remove the cover. Place the red mullets in the centre of dish and sprinkle lightly with paprika. Re-cover and bake covered at 250 degrees for 20 to 25 minutes or until the fish flakes easily with a fork.

  • Serves: 2

Ingredients:

  • 2 red mullets (whole, scaled and gutted)
  • 1 cup of rice
  • 3 cups hot fish stock
  • 2-3 cloves of garlic
  • 1 onion (finely chopped)
  • A small bunch of fresh thyme
  • 2 teaspoons of dry mixed herbs
  • 1 tbsp. grated Parmesan cheese
  • Paprika (optional)
